Everyday AI Podcast – An AI and ChatGPT Podcast

EP 457: Gemini 2.0 – Google's Logan Kilpatrick gives inside scoop on Gemini updates

07 Feb 2025

Description

One of the smartest leaders in AI is taking us to Gemini school. Google just released its highly anticipated Gemini 2.0 updates. Logan Kilpatrick is the Senior Product Manager at Google DeepMind and is widely considered one of the leading voices in AI development. What better way to learn about Google’s groundbreaking model update than straight from the source?
